Bitcoin traded at $115,000 on Tuesday, while Ethereum slipped to $4,200 amid market movements. At the time of writing, the total crypto market cap saw a marginal dip of 0.05 per cent to $3.88 trillion, while the 24-hour trading volume increased by 12.44 per cent to $180.53 billion.
Bitcoin BTC was the most trending cryptocurrency. Its price was down by 0.28 per cent to $115,154.69, and its 24-hour trading volume was $61.28 billion. Elsewhere OKB was the top gainer. It was up by 10.62 per cent, and its 24-hour trading volume was $265.08 million. Pump.fun PUMP was the top loser. It was down by 8.88 per cent, while its 24-hour trading volume was $258.90 million.
The DeFi market cap was at $40.36 billion, Coinmarketcap.com reported.
Sathvik Vishwanath, Co-Founder & CEO, Unocoin said, “Bitcoin is navigating a critical zone at $115,500, where buyers and sellers are finely balanced. The market’s safety net lies at $115,000, with deeper cushions stacked at $114,000 and $112,000, levels that historically attract strong demand. A sharper fallback could even test the $109,000 base, a zone that has anchored prior rebounds. On the upside, $116,500 is the first real gate to unlock momentum, followed by $119,000 and the psychological $121,000 mark. Should enthusiasm intensify, $123,000 becomes the defining battleground. Current positioning suggests Bitcoin is coiling for its next decisive move, with volatility set to reawaken.”
